Yana Myaskovsky

Spécialisation

I use integrative approach: dynamic, cognitive-behavioral therapy and integrating methods, according to the diagnosis and patient's needs

A propos de moi
 Therapy and treatment:

·  Selection and application of interventions, methods and techniques within the context of psychodynamic individual therapy 

·  Selection and application of interventions, methods and techniques within the framework of cognitive behavioral therapy, the use of both behavioral and cognitive aspects and various methods from the first, second and third wave of cognitive behavioral therapy such as ACT, DBT, schema therapy, MBCT, etc. 

  Professional Experience

May 2023- ongoing   Independent practice for psychotherapy

Jun 2021- Dec 2022         Yona AG ´`- Psychotherapist in the outpatient medical institution (Zürich,  Switzerland). 

 

Jan 2020 – ongoing           CBT Lecturer and Group Supervisor - Cognitive and Behavior Psychotherapy Integrative Program, Psychology Department, the University of Haifa: Teaching multiple topics, such  as Depressive Disorder, Panic Disorder, etc. Group supervision at the program. 

 

Jan 2015 – ongoing            Expert Psychologist and Supervisor - CBT Center – Expert Clinic for Psychological Treatment 

·      Supervision,  Treating a variety of patients with a wide range of mental illnesses: complex psychopathology and difficult life crises. 

·      Experience in a variety of cognitive-behavioral therapeutic methods, as well as psychodynamic psychotherapy .
 

Jan 2015 – Feb 2019           Hospitalization Resident and Expert Clinical Psychologist - Acute Open Mental Health Unit in Mazor Mental Health Center 

·       Treating a variety of patients with a wide range of mental illnesses: depression, anxiety, OCD, bi-polar, schizoaffective disorder, schizophrenia, acute psychotic episodes, personality disorders and difficultlife crises. Performing psychodynamic, cognitive- behavioral and rehabilitation therapy and psychodynamic diagnostic tests .

·       Group therapy: conducting biweekly group therapy sessions for the open unit patients.

·       Performing individual and group training for the Mental Health Center staff, therapy-based workshops for the Center’s psychologists and hospital staff.

·       Experience in a variety of therapeutic methods: dynamic therapy, cognitive-behavioral therapy and integrating methods, according to the patients’ needs . 

 Jan 2010 – Oct 2014         Clinical Residency - Children, Youth and Family Treatment Center, Tirat Ha-Carmel 

·       Experience in a variety of psychotherapy methods treating children and youth and providing therapy for the parents.
 ·       Performing psychodynamic diagnoses for children and youth and conducting new patient intakes.

·       Collaborating with official authorities: the Israeli Ministry of Education, Psychiatric Services, Welfare, etc.
